When you think of Pulse Oximeters you probably think of hospitals, clinics or doctor offices. You wouldn't think to find one in your everyday office environment, would you? But with the advancement in medical technology, these devices are now completely portable and affordable. This is great news for people who need to monitor their oxygen saturation levels throughout the day.Asthma sufferers are a great example of people who need to own their own Oximeter. By testing throughout the day, they are able to monitor their levels and know when they need to use their inhaler. A simple thing as dust in the office could trigger an asthma attack and it is always better to remedy it before it actually occurs.Many people already use portable medical devices such as a blood pressure monitor, pedometer or a glucose monitor. Adding an Oximeter to that list is now possible. While at work your level of exercise is at a minimum. It is important to know your pulse rate at rest throughout the day. Knowing and understanding these vital sign measurements is a good indication of how hard your heart works throughout the day under various work related conditions.Pulse Oximeters are now available for under $100, which makes it easily accessible for anyone who in interested in understanding how their body functions throughout the day.
